Aerogel represents a cutting-edge material used in high-quality rehabilitation and new construction. It is characterized by being an ultralight insulation with exceptional thermal insulation capacity, originally developed for aerospace applications.
Its application in the residential sector allows:
In Catalonia, its use is particularly relevant in heritage value properties, where efficiency improvement must harmonize with the conservation of architectural identity.

One of the most innovative —and less obvious— aspects of contemporary housing is the implementation of circadian lighting design, which is based on the interconnection between natural light, human biological rhythms, and well-being.
This approach aims to:
It is a strategy that goes beyond advanced artificial lighting, constituting a holistic planning of orientation, openings, shadow management, and color temperature, aligned with real occupancy dynamics.
